All the Monstera fame, a fraction of the floor space. I'm the Monstera Adansonii - the Swiss Cheese Vine - and my heart-shaped leaves come pre-holed from the start. Botanists reckon those holes are 'skylights' that let light through to my lower leaves back in the rainforest. Nature's clever like that.

I'm a fast, enthusiastic trailer: hang me high, drape me along a shelf, or hand me a totem and watch me climb. Bright, indirect light, and keep my soil lightly moist - I like my rainforest vibes consistent.

Feeding your indoor plants

To get the best out of your indoor plants, you will need to feed them some food. The Good Plant Co Indoor Plant Food will provide all the nutrients they need to grow more leaves and help them stay strong. When the plant is actively growing during the warmer months, it needs a bit more food and water. During the slow growing season (cooler winter months) your plant doesn’t eat or drink as much (no extra winter layer of fat for these babies). Sometimes it’s ok to be a helicopter parent – respond to your plant’s needs. To keep the dust off your beautiful indoor plant leaves use The Good Plant Co Leaf Shine. Moral of the story, if it is growing new leaves then it will need more water and food!
